
Ah, graduation season, a time when teenagers on the brink of adulthood can cut loose for one final summer before beginning four years of unbridled heartache, academic self-doubt, and Molly addiction. For many, graduating high school is a momentous occasion and a chance to show Nana and Peepa that you’re not a complete waste of organs. Or, alternately it’s a chance to tell everyone what a massive Slipknot fan you are, which one high schooler did by receiving his diploma to the Iowan band’s classic track “People = Shit.”
As you’ll see in the video below, one Redditor made a point of receiving his high school diploma to the opening track of 2001’s Iowa. The crowd seems a little bewildered, but mostly amused. More than anything, though, this video will let metal fans know how good these damn kids today have it. This writer 100% did not have the option of choosing a soundtrack for receiving his diploma; if anything, it was made clear to him that he was lucky to be graduating at all, and if he in any way sullied this occasion with his metalheaddom, the coaches might take him out back and kick him to death.
